In addition to the required annual disclosures, PIs and PDs are asked to declare whether or not a conflict of interest exists for each project proposed, either on their part or that of others named in the proposal.
The Duke individuals listed below are required to submit a COI form online if they fulfill any of the following criteria at any point during the disclosure period:
Graduate and Undergraduate Students are exempt from this requirement unless indicated as key personnel on a sponsored program.
